基于RIT113软件验证加速器等中心精度的可行性研究

Feasibility Research of RIT113 Software for Verifying Accuracy of Accelerator Isocenter

【摘要】 目的 评估RIT113软件验证加速器等中心精度的可行性。方法 结合电子射野影像装置(Electronics Portal Image Device,EPID)采集的图像,测试RIT113软件分析6 MV均整器模式(Flatten Filter,FF)和6 MV无均整器模式(Flatten FilterFree,FFF)两种不同能量X射线下等中心的重复性和准确性。重复性:在保持小球位置不动,机架、治疗床和准直器角度均为0°的情况下重复采集10次EPID图像,使用RIT113软件分析小球位置变化情况。准确性:LAT(左右)、VRT(上下)、LNG(左右)方向上分别引入已知位移(-1.0~1.0mm),步径0.25mm,使用RIT113软件对采集到的图像进行分析,得到测量结果与实际引入位移的偏差。结果 RIT113软件在6 MV FF X射线情况下验证加速器等中心时,在LAT和LNG方向上归一后重复性分别为0.994±0.031和0.998±0.009;6MVFFFX射线情况下,在LAT和LNG方向上归一后重复性分别为1.000±0.009和1.001±0.014。RIT113软件在6 MV FF X射线下的LAT、LNG和VRT方向上准确性分别为(0.026±0.005)、(0.041±0.014)和(0.018±0.009)mm,而在6 MV FFF X射线下的LAT、LNG和VRT方向上准确性分别为(0.015±0.008)、(0.023±0.017)和(0.015±0.014)mm。结论 RIT113软件在加速器等中心验证上重复性和准确性良好,能够满足临床需求。

【Abstract】 Objective To evaluate the feasibility of RIT113 software for verifying the accuracy of accelerator isocenter.Methods The repeatability and accuracy of RIT113 isocenter verification with 6 MV Flatten Filter(FF) and 6 MV Flatten Filter Free(FFF) X-ray were tested by combining the images acquired by an electronics portal image device(EPID).Repeatability:Images were acquired using an EPID for 10 times without altering the position of the ball with the angle of gantry,couch and collimator all 0°,RIT113 software was used to analyze the changes of the ball position.Accuracy:The known shifts were applied to the ball in lateral(LAT),lengthways(LNG) and vertical(VRT) direction from-1.0 mm to +1.0 mm in steps of 0.25 mm.RIT113software was used to analyze the collected images acquired from EPID to obtain the deviation between the measurement results and the actual shift.Results The normalized repeatability of RIT113 isocenter verification with 6 MV X-rays in LAT and LNG were respectively 0.994±0.031 and 0.998±0.009.The normalized repeatability of RIT113 isocenter verification with 6 MV FFF X-rays in LAT and LNG were respectively 1.000±0.009 and 1.001±0.014.The accuracy of RIT113 isocenter verification with 6 MV FF X-rays in LAT,LNG and VRT were respectively(0.026±0.005),(0.041±0.014) and(0.018±0.009) mm.The accuracy of RIT113isocenter verification with 6 MV FFF X-rays in LAT,LNG and VRT were(0.015±0.008),(0.023±0.017) and(0.015±0.014) mm.Conclusion RIT113 software has good repeatability and accuracy in accelerator and other center validation,and can meet clinical needs.
